▸ verb: (transitive) To obtain access to something; to meet the requirements of a security or protection system.
▸ verb: (transitive, mobile telephony) To configure (a mobile phone) so that it is not bound to any particular carrier.
▸ verb: (transitive) To disclose or reveal previously unknown knowledge or potential.
▸ verb: (intransitive) To be or become unfastened or unrestrained.
▸ verb: (transitive, figurative) To make available.
▸ verb: (transitive) To undermine something that has control over a situation; to find a way to counter or oppose.
▸ noun: The act of unlocking something.
▸ noun: (video games) An initially hidden feature that is made available to reward the player for some achievement.
